WebMar 24, 2024 · There are seven main insects and bugs that can crawl up your drain: drain flies, fungus gnats, cockroaches, fruit flies, phorid flies, psocid mites (or booklice) and Spiders. However, spiders only crawl up unused drains. To get rid of drain insects, you can pour boiling water, bleach, or a mixture of vinegar and baking soda down the drain.

The CG range is quite wide, but with … downs rational choice theoryWebThe Ringneck Pheasant: The Fly Tyer's Friend. There's probably not a bird that flies that has more uses for the fly tyer than the ringneck pheasant. From the top of its head to the tip of its tail, there's hardly a feather on a pheasant that can't be used to some good purpose.
